2007-10-01から1ヶ月間の記事一覧

タップイベントの限界を見るテスト

http://touch.wakufactory.jp/sample/canvas2.html タップペイントとでも申しましょうか。 ゆっくりまったり操作してください。

メモ iPod touch Safariのイベント処理まとめ

onload,onunloadは有効 エレメントに関しては、onclickのみが事実上有効 エレメントのfocusが移動したときに、onmouseover,onmouseoutが1回だけ発生する onmousedown,onmouseupも発生しているが、onclickと同時に発生するので、「押した瞬間」は取得できない…

iPod touch ベンチマーク的な その2

canvasを使って図形をアニメーションしてみるサンプル。 http://touch.wakufactory.jp/sample/canvas1.html IEではうごかないよ。動きが多少ぎこちないが、ちゃんと音楽再生しながら動く。

iPod touchベンチマーク的な

新しい環境でとりあえず作ってみるのが恒例になっている一品。 いわゆるひとつのLife Game。 http://touch.wakufactory.jp/sample/minilife.html 京ぽんのOperaよりは大分速い。

持ち出し用googlemap

iPod touch用googlemap第2弾。オンライン状態で、大きめの地図を読み込んでおいて、オフラインでも拡大したりスクロールしたりして見られるようにする試み。 http://wakufactory.jp/map/google_touch2.html 左上のonlineボタンを押すと、オフラインモードに…

iPod用動画一括変換スクリプト

iPod touch用のmpeg4動画を一括で作るwshスクリプトを書いてみた。コンセプトは、 新しいのだけ勝手に変換 変換パラメータを動画の種類に応じて自動的に切り換える というもの。エンコーダは「携帯動画変換君」に付属のffmpegを使用。iTunesに登録するのに、…

スクロールとズームを取得するテスト

上のを参考にスクロールとズームの動作を取得するテストページを作った。 http://touch.wakufactory.jp/sample/scroll.html スクロールするとwindow.onscrollイベントが発生。 左上の座標はwindow.pageXOffset,window.pageYOffsetで、 「いま見えてる範囲の…

これはすごい

Safariのスクロール、拡大機能を自分で制御してドラッグできるgooglemapを作っている。 http://d.hatena.ne.jp/kstn/20071006/1191627848 iPod Touchでプレゼンしてるってのも素敵。

iPod touch向けgooglemap

googlemapをiPod touch向けに作ってみたVer.1 http://wakufactory.jp/map/google_touch.html googlemapの特徴であるところのマウスドラッグによるスクロールが、touchでは使えないので、とりあえずの対応として、クリックしたところが中心に移動するようにし…

Safariで動画再生

Safariで動画再生をするためのタグ。embedだけでよい。サムネイル画像はsrcで指定。 フォーマットは(たぶん)転送して再生可能なものは大丈夫。 実際にはブラウザ上で再生されるわけではなくて、再生ボタンを押すとQTプレイヤーが起動して再生される。縦モー…

向きを取得するイベント

js

当初無いとされていた、iPod touch本体の向きを取得するイベントが、1.1.1のファームで追加されたようだ。 向きが変わると、bodyのonOrientationChangeイベントが上がり、window.orientationの値で向きが分かるようになっている。 実例サンプルはこちら http…

iPod touchでの画像の拡大

iTunes経由でsyncした画像は、どんなに大きくても一定サイズに縮小されてとりこまれてしまう。 したがって拡大も限界があり、高解像度の画像を拡大して細部まで見るのには適さない。Safari経由だと、大きな画像もフルサイズまで拡大することができる。 さら…

iTunes操作用スクリプト

vbsを使ったiTunesに登録されたデータの属性を操作する例 http://www1.atwiki.jp/itunes/pages/26.html

ようやく時間ができてゆっくりいじれるようになったので、tipsネタをいくつか。